- /*
- * The PBL can load up to 64 bytes at a time, so we split the U-Boot
- * image into 64 byte chunks. PBL needs a command for each piece, of
- * the form "81xxxxxx", where "xxxxxx" is the offset. SYS_TEXT_BASE
- * is 0xFFF80000 for PBL boot, and PBL only cares about low 24-bit,
- * so it starts from 0x81F80000.
- */

- static uint32_t crc_table[256];
- static void make_crc_table(void)
- {
- uint32_t mask;
- int i, j;
- uint32_t poly; /* polynomial exclusive-or pattern */
- /*
- * the polynomial used by PBL is 1 + x1 + x2 + x4 + x5 + x7 + x8 + x10
- * + x11 + x12 + x16 + x22 + x23 + x26 + x32.
- */
- poly = 0x04c11db7;
- for (i = 0; i < 256; i++) {
- mask = i << 24;
- for (j = 0; j < 8; j++) {
- if (mask & 0x80000000)
- mask = (mask << 1) ^ poly;
- else
- mask <<= 1;
- }
- crc_table[i] = mask;
- }
- }
- unsigned long pbl_crc32(unsigned long crc, const char *buf, uint32_t len)
- {
- uint32_t crc32_val = 0xffffffff;
- uint32_t xor = 0x0;
- int i;
- make_crc_table();
- for (i = 0; i < len; i++)
- crc32_val = (crc32_val << 8) ^
- crc_table[(crc32_val >> 24) ^ (*buf++ & 0xff)];
- crc32_val = crc32_val ^ xor;
- if (crc32_val < 0) {
- crc32_val += 0xffffffff;
- crc32_val += 1;
- }
- return crc32_val;
- }
